iSDK - 无法调用函数sendEmail(未定义函数)

时间:2014-02-12 08:41:13

标签: php api infusionsoft

我正在使用此API“https://github.com/infusionsoft/PHP-iSDK”。 我在一个简单的php文件中调用它,但我有一个错误,我是一个简单的解决方案,我是新的PHP任何正文,这是我的代码。

<?php
  echo "Hello World! <br/>";
  include_once('iSDK/src/isdk.php');
  $myApp = new iSDK;

  if($myApp->cfgCon("connectionName")) {
      echo "Connected...";
  } else {
      echo "Not Connected...";
  }

  sendEmail('conList','fromAddress','toAddress', 'ccAddresses', 'bccAddresses', 'contentType', 'subject', 'htmlBody', 'txtBody');
?>

以下代码会出现此错误:

Call to undefined function sendEmail() in C:\xampp\htdocs\test\email.php on line 16

1 个答案:

答案 0 :(得分:1)

这是此代码中唯一的错误吗?

看起来php无法在iSDK中找到该功能。 行nclude_once'iSDK/src/isdk.php';应为include_once('iSDK/src/isdk.php');,如果相对路径正确,则应检查。

下一行中的第一个字符也丢失了:myApp = new iSDK;应为$myApp = new iSDK();

第二个猜测是写$myApp->sendEmail(而不是sendEmail(